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Resource scheduling method for cloud system

A resource scheduling and cloud system technology, applied in the field of resource scheduling of cloud systems, can solve problems such as high energy consumption, low resource utilization, and high resource utilization

Active Publication Date: 2015-09-09
BEIJING UNIV OF POSTS & TELECOMM
View PDF4 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007] (2) round robin algorithm: the advantage is that the load is balanced but the energy consumption is high
[0008] (3) power save algorithm: the advantage is that the energy consumption is reduced but the resource utilization rate is low
[0009] For standards such as load balancing, high resource utilization, and low migration cost, these goals cannot be met simultaneously in one scheduling algorithm

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Resource scheduling method for cloud system
  • Resource scheduling method for cloud system
  • Resource scheduling method for cloud system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0039] The implementation of the present invention will be described in detail below in conjunction with the accompanying drawings and examples, so that implementers of the present invention can fully understand how the present invention uses technical means to solve technical problems, and achieve the realization process of technical effects and according to the above-mentioned realization process The present invention is implemented concretely. It should be noted that, as long as there is no conflict, each embodiment and each feature in each embodiment of the present invention can be combined with each other, and the formed technical solutions are all within the protection scope of the present invention.

[0040] Cloud computing is to provide computing, storage and network infrastructure distributed in different data centers, as well as the development platform, software and applications on it, to users in the form of services through the Internet. During the normal use of c...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ention discloses a resource scheduling method for a cloud system. The method comprises the following steps of: in a population initialization step, an alternative scheme of resource scheduling of the cloud system is obtained, and initial population is created by utilizing the alternative scheme; in a fitness function creation step, a total fitness function is created for specific demands of resource scheduling of the cloud system; in a population screening step, individuals in the initial population are screened by utilizing the total fitness function to obtain fitted individuals; and in a resource scheduling step, a virtual machine and a node controller are subjected to resource scheduling according to the alternative scheme corresponding to the fitted individuals. Compared to the prior art, the resource scheduling method disclosed by the present invention is relatively low in transfer cost while realizing good load balancing result.

Description

technical field [0001] The invention relates to the field of computer technology, in particular to a resource scheduling method for a cloud system. Background technique [0002] Cloud computing is to provide computing, storage and network infrastructure distributed in different data centers, as well as the development platform, software and applications on it, to users in the form of services through the Internet. Because cloud computing has the characteristics of charging on demand, saving costs, and making full use of resources, the world has entered the era of cloud computing. [0003] The resources of the cloud computing application platform are widely distributed and of various types. Generally, the cloud computing application platform will reasonably allocate resources to users according to the user's usage requirements, so that the load of the entire cloud computing application platform is balanced. However, during the normal use of cloud computing, users' demands of...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/50
Inventor 李小勇张锐
Owner BEIJING UNIV OF POSTS & TELECOMM
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products